Tess:
Between Elliott and me, I am not the difficult one. He unfairly blames me for the messy way we met, which created our current inability to be around each other without arguing. After a tragic loss and a surprising stipulation in my grandpa's will, Elliott proposes a marriage of convenience, as if that'll solve all our problems. Unfortunately, it solves one problem so perfectly that I can't help but agree. Falling for my convenient, short-term husband is a terrible idea, yet I'm well on my way.
Someone should wish me luck because I'm going to need it.
So will he.
Elliott:
While there's something I'll never forgive Tess Macari for, I also can't get her out of my head. I definitely can't stand by and watch her marry someone else to fix the mess her grandfather made. If Tess and I can't convince everyone we're in love, we'll lose the only thing we have left of her grandpa. My friendship with him was unconventional, and some would say I'm as grumpy as he ever was, but walking away from Tess isn't an option.
This is happening. The real marriage. The fake relationship. Tess will have to deal with it. All I have to figure out is how to not fall in love with her.
